Are Cars Allowed On Mackinac Island

When it comes to planning a trip to Mackinac Island, one question that often comes up is whether cars are allowed on the island. Well, the answer is no! Mackinac Island has a long-standing tradition of being a car-free destination, making it a unique and charming getaway. Ferry Service to Mackinac Island

Two companies operate ferry boats that transport visitors to Mackinac Island during the primary tourist season, which runs from late April through October. These ferry companies have docks in both Mackinaw City, at the northern tip of Michigan’s Lower Peninsula, and St. Ignace, at the southern tip of the Upper Peninsula[^1^]. Shepler’s Mackinac Island Ferry

One of the ferry companies, Shepler’s Mackinac Island Ferry, offers convenient day and overnight parking options in both Mackinaw City and St. Ignace. Their boats depart every 30 minutes or so during the season, and the ride to Mackinac Island takes about 15 minutes[^2^]. You even have the option to board a ferry that goes under the iconic Mackinac Bridge, adding an extra thrill to your journey[^2^].

Reservations are not required for Shepler’s Mackinac Island Ferry, and you can purchase tickets in advance online. The pricing for the ferry is the same regardless of whether you depart from Mackinaw City or St. Ignace[^2^].

Mackinac Island Ferry Company

The other ferry company, Mackinac Island Ferry Company, also provides convenient parking options in both Mackinaw City and St. Ignace. Their boats depart every 30 minutes or so during the season, and you can choose between a direct passage to Mackinac Island or a slightly longer trip that takes you under the Mackinac Bridge[^3^].

Similar to Shepler’s, you can purchase tickets for the Mackinac Island Ferry Company in advance online, and reservations are not required. The ferry pricing remains the same, whether you depart from Mackinaw City or St. Ignace[^3^].

Other Tips for Your Mackinac Island Ferry Experience

Both Shepler’s and Mackinac Island Ferry Company allow visitors to bring bikes on board for a small fee, making it easy to explore the island at your own pace[^3^]. Additionally, pets are welcome on the ferry boats, so you don’t have to leave your furry friends behind when you visit Mackinac Island[^3^].

Upon arrival at Mackinac Island, each ferry company has its own dock where you can disembark and gather any luggage or bicycles you brought with you. Some accommodations have dockporters who will take your bags straight to your room, making your arrival hassle-free. It’s always a good idea to check with your place of stay in advance regarding luggage arrangements[^4^].

All ferry docks on Mackinac Island are conveniently located right in town, close to various restaurants, accommodations, and popular attractions such as Mackinac Island Carriage Tours, Great Turtle Kayak Tours, Fort Mackinac, and many fudge shops and bike rental vendors[^4^]. You can easily immerse yourself in the island’s charm and explore everything it has to offer within walking distance of the ferry dock.

Both Shepler’s and Mackinac Island Ferry Company offer packages that combine ferry tickets with admission to various Mackinac Island attractions and activities. By purchasing a package, you might be able to enjoy special pricing for attractions like Fort Mackinac or a narrated horse-drawn carriage tour[^4^].

Alternative Transportation Options

If ferry travel isn’t your cup of tea or you’re looking for a faster way to reach Mackinac Island, you can also consider flying. The flight from St. Ignace to Mackinac Island Airport takes only 7 minutes[^5^]! Charter flights are available from Pellston Regional Airport in the Lower Peninsula or Chippewa County International Airport in the Upper Peninsula to Mackinac Island[^5^]. If you choose this option, make sure to arrange horse-drawn taxi transportation from the Mackinac Island airport to your place of stay[^5^].

During the winter months when the Straits of Mackinac freeze over, the only way to reach Mackinac Island is by plane. However, for most of the winter, ferry service is still available, albeit on a limited schedule. Mackinac Island Ferry Company runs passenger boats between Mackinac Island and the mainland, allowing visitors to enjoy the island’s enchantment even when the temperatures drop[^5^].
